Early in the episode, Laura is extremely determined to be responsible for when the new teacher comes, as evidenced by her effort to boss the other children around and get them in their seats. This is the first time we see Laura act so "teacher-ese," and she only gets more eager about it in future seasons. Furthermore, the fact that she doesn't want to start off on the wrong foot with a new teacher is clearly a link to her awful experience with Mr. Applewood in Season 2's Troublemaker.
